Description

You take compulsory modules (120 credits) which typically include: international business strategy; purchasing and supply chain management; introduction to financial reporting; operations management; international logistics; performance and decision management; quality management, tools and techniques; research methods. Finally you complete your studies with a research dissertation (60 credits).

Requirements

Normally an upper-second-class (2.1) Honours degree in any subject or international equivalent. Applicants whose first language is not English require IELTS 6.5 or equivalent, with no less than 6.0 in any element.
